  5. The Shubenacadie Provincial Wildlife Park is a government-operated wildlife park located in Shubenacadie, Nova Scotia, Canada. The 40-hectare park includes animals, an interpretive nature centre operated by Ducks Unlimited Canada, hiking trails, a picnic area and playground.
